About the Role:

In this role, you will play a pivotal role in safeguarding the company's critical IT infrastructure and ensuring seamless network operations. You'll leverage your expertise in network & security best practices to develop, implement, and manage robust network & security solutions that are resilient and protect against cyber threats.

Responsibilities

  • Design, implement, and maintain secure network architecture for optimal performance and scalability
  • Configure and administer routers, switches and access points
  • Configure and administer firewalls, intrusion detection/prevention systems (IDS/IPS), and other security tools
  • Conduct regular vulnerability assessments to identify and mitigate security risks
  • Monitor network activity for suspicious behavior
  • Manage user access controls and establish security policies and procedures
  • Troubleshoot network connectivity issues and diagnose network performance problems
  • Stay up-to-date on emerging cyber threats and implement necessary security updates
  • Collaborate with IT teams to ensure network security aligns with business objectives
  • Document network configurations, security policies, and procedures

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field (or equivalent experience)
  • 3-5+ years of experience in a network and security role
  • Experience with Cisco Routing & Switching, Cisco DNA, Cisco ISE, Cisco ACI
  • Proven experience in designing, implementing, and managing network & security solutions
  • Strong understanding of network security concepts (firewalls, VPNs, IDS/IPS, etc.)
  • Experience with network & security tools and technologies (e.g. Checkpoint, Fortinet, Firewall Analyzer tool)
